摘要
以溶液聚合法合成了以 4 [(N ,N 二 β 羟乙基 )氨基 ] 4’ 硝基偶氮苯为染料单体的共聚酯染料 ,通过紫外 可见光谱、核磁共振对共聚酯染料的结构进行了表征。热分析结果表明 ,共聚酯染料具有较好的热稳定性 ,热分解过程主要分两个阶段进行。对共聚酯染料在有机溶剂中的溶解性的研究结果表明 ,共聚酯染料比染料单体耐溶剂萃取性能好。
The copolyester dye bearing azo group is synthesized by solution polycondensation Its structure is characterized by UV VIS,NMR spectra and TG technique The results of thermal analysis show that the copolyester dye possesses excellent thermal stability and the thermal degradation process can be divided into two stages The solubility of copolyester dye in organic solvent is also studied in this paper,which showed that the solvent extraction resistance of copolyester dye is better than that of dye monomer
